The objective of this paper is to conduct an analytical exercise on dysfunctions observed in the formulation and implementation of public policies of the media in relation to the gender issue. Despite the efforts made by Morocco to include the gender dimension in public media policies, the situation of women in the media landscape remains precarious. Whether at the level of the exercise of media-related businesses, the engagement in the media programs or access to positions of responsibility, Moroccan women are very poorly represented. Even more surprising, the media contribute to widen the gap between the actual value of Moroccan women and the image that one has of herself. Morocco is a long way to go before all the legitimate aspirations of women are reached.
